Question : Device Manager is Blank
My speakers stop working and I believe a sound card driver was uninstalled. I went to the Device manager to see what the sound card is and there is nothing listed at all, for anything. System is windows XP Pro.
I am logged in as administrator.
Answer : Device Manager is Blank
goto start>run>regedit and open this folder
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\
CurrentCon
trolSet\Se
rvices\Plu
gPlay
look in the right pane for the ImagePath key and make sure that its value is set to
%SystemRoot%\system32\serv
ices.exe
